Lenovo is seeking a Data Analyst to support the Internal Audit function.
Primary Responsibilities
This position will play a pivotal role in building and growing the data analytics capabilities in Internal Audit at Lenovo. The primary role of the Data Analyst is to identify, design and develop data analytics routines to support audit activities performed by the Internal Audit team. Maintain an effective system of data analytics and models which provide enhanced insight into risks and controls, establishes an efficient/automated means to analyze and test large volumes of data for outliers, anomalies, patterns, and trends, and helps evaluate the adequacy and effectiveness of controls. Create repeatable data analytics to support continuous audit monitoring programs.
- Identify, design, and develop data analytics extract routines to support all phases of audit activities performed by the Internal Audit team, including risk assessment, planning, and scoping, testing and reporting.
- Manage data extraction, storage, transformation, and processing through data analytics routines, and generate output for visualization/analysis by the Internal Audit team.
- Identify and develop innovative and re-usable analytics solutions to drive auditor self-service.
- Use data analysis tools to automate audit testing and develop techniques for continuous auditing and analyzing large volumes of data.
- Interact with management and business partners to identify appropriate data sources and data elements required for analytics, applying professional skepticism when assessing data sources and validating the completeness and accuracy of data received.
- Transfer appropriate knowledge to the Data Champions and wider Internal Audit team in relation to data, systems, and data analytics queries
- Interact and collaborate with Internal Audit team members in working towards departmental goals.
- Execute on special projects and other assignments as requested by management.

Position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in business, mathematics, computer science, or management information systems.
- 3-5 years of relevant/recent data analysis experience in audit, financial, risk management, or technology functions.
- Strong quantitative, analytical, data-intuition, and problem-solving skills, and proficiency in data analytics techniques.
- Strong knowledge and proficiency in extraction and analysis of data from a wide variety of data sources, data analysis tools (PowerBI preferred), process mining, Alteryx/KNIME, SQL, visualization tools, R, python, etc.
- Preferred knowledge and experience in the manufacturing, high tech industries.
- Experience building and supporting continuous audit monitoring programs.
- Working knowledge of internal controls and auditing techniques.
- Strong communication and relationship building skills.
- Must be open to travel (upto 20%)
- Optional Certifications: CIA, CISA
